Job Description
We are looking for a sharp, highly motivated individual to manage the supply growth across the US. This role requires a combination of leadership, analytical problem solving, stakeholder engagement, project management as well as a can-do attitude, eagerness to learn and appetite for hands-on operational tasks.
What you’ll do
- [Hands-on, in-market execution] You will need to visit the cities and engage with drivers, couriers and potential drivers directly to understand what are the levers you’ll need to scale and apply to grow the supply and give qualitative feedback to the team to improve the marketplace management.
- [Dashboarding and growth levers building] You will need to build your own dashboards and test and scale specific growth levers (CRMs, incentives).
- [Cross-functional Collaboration] You will need to engage with the teams that manage them, understand how they work and how you can leverage them.
- [Strategy & Planning] You will work with EMEA and US team to design the operational strategy & setup for supply growth.
